Cinema Retro Volume 20 #60 (Mature)

Description:
Nicholas Anez looks at No Love for Jonnie (1961), a political drama in which Peter Finch gives an outstanding performance; "Selling Bond": Dave Worrall tells the remarkable story of how a British cinema promoted the release of the James Bond adventure Goldfinger in late September 1964, which coincides with the films 60th anniversary; regular contributor Simon Lewis gives us an Omar Sharif 'Film in Focus' double bill covering The Last Valley and The Horsemen, both released in 1971; "Hammer Unmade": John LeMay looks at the aborted attempt by Britain's famous horror film company to join forces with Japan's Toho Studios to make a film about the Loch Ness Monster; Morten Sagen interviews titles animator Trevor Bond, who worked, amongst others, on the early James Bond films.
